BRAIN Program

The BRAIN Program is available to all parents of newborns in Martin and St. Lucie counties to help give children the best start possible. Here’s what we offer...

Newborn Home Visit from a hospital nurse, which includes:

  • Mother/baby physical assessment
  • Breastfeeding support & education
  • Immunization schedule
  • Home safety information

Two-month Home Visit from Helping People Succeed, which includes:

  • Gifts for parents and baby
  • Information on brain development and the importance of nurturing during the first years of life
  • The Ages and Stages Developmental Monitoring system
  • Information about community resources for parents and their baby

Offered in partnership with Cleveland Clinic Martin Health, Lawnwood Regional Medical Center, St. Lucie Medical Center, and Home Safe of Palm Beach County.
